Adventures Kayaking is a kayak outfitter based in Fort Myers Beach, Florida, offering guided eco tours and short-term kayak rentals. The business runs a Guided Eco Tour to Big Hickory Island and a range of timed rental options — 1 hour, 2 hours, 3 hours, and 4 hours — designed for visitors seeking beach access, wildlife viewing, and shallow-water exploration.
All rentals include coast-appropriate safety equipment: life vests and dry boxes. Instructors provide on-water lessons and basic paddling instruction so first-time kayakers can feel comfortable before launching. Several rental options highlight a hidden beach reachable in approximately 15 minutes by kayak from the Fort Myers Beach launch area.
The Guided Eco Tour to Big Hickory Island focuses on local ecology and shoreline habitats, guided along scenic routes. Longer rental windows, such as the 3- and 4-hour options, allow more time for exploration and beach stops, while the 1- and 2-hour rentals suit quick outings or families with limited time.

Wear Water Shoes
Sharp oyster shells often cover the beach and shoreline, so sturdy water shoes protect your feet when entering and exiting the kayak.
Use Provided Dry Boxes
Keep your phone, camera, and valuables safe and dry in the included dry boxes—essential for coastal paddling.
Review the Route Map Before Launch
Adventures Kayaking provides detailed maps and lessons so you feel confident navigating to the secluded beach and back.
Apply Sunscreen Generously
Florida sun can intensify quickly out on the water; apply and reapply sunscreen even on cloudy days.
